Why EMI Matters for Outdoor Power Systems
Outdoor power supplies face unique challenges from electromagnetic interference (EMI), especially in industrial and renewable energy applications. Imagine trying to hold a clear phone conversation during a thunderstorm – that's what uncontrolled EMI does to sensitive electronic equipment. From solar farms to telecom infrastructure, understanding EMI is crucial for system reliability.
Top Industries Affected by EMI
- Solar energy installations (particularly inverter systems)
- Electric vehicle charging stations
- 5G network infrastructure
- Industrial automation equipment
- Outdoor LED lighting systems

Practical EMI Mitigation Strategies
Here's what actually works based on 2023 industry surveys:
Hardware Solutions
- Twisted pair wiring for signal transmission
- EMI suppression filters (rated for outdoor use)
- Galvanic isolation components
Software Solutions
- Adaptive frequency hopping
- Error correction algorithms
- Real-time interference monitoring

FAQ: EMI in Outdoor Power Systems
- Q: How does EMI affect solar inverters? A: Can cause erratic switching and reduced conversion efficiency
- Q: What's the cost of EMI protection? A: Typically 5-8% of system cost, varying by protection level
